Charge Up to 50% Faster with GaN Adapters

Noise Power Series features GaN adapters that claim to significantly reduce charging times. The adapters boast the ability to juice up your devices from 0 to 50% in just 30 minutes, a substantial improvement over traditional chargers. On top of the speed boost, GaN technology also offers a compact design. These adapters are claimed to be up to 50% smaller than traditional chargers, making them perfect for travel or portability.

Unleash Convenience with Magnetic Cables

The Noise Power Series also introduces a magnetic Type-C cable for enhanced convenience. The magnetic connector allows for easy one-handed connection and disconnection, eliminating the frustration of fumbling with cables in low-light situations. Additionally, the magnetic connection can act as a breakaway point if you accidentally trip over the cable, potentially saving your device from a fall.

The Noise Power Series appears to be a compelling offering for those seeking a faster and more convenient charging experience. Here’s a deeper dive into the product’s features and some additional considerations:

GaN Technology: GaN is a next-generation material that offers several advantages over traditional silicon-based chargers. GaN generates less heat during operation, allowing for a smaller form factor and potentially improved efficiency. However, it’s important to note that the real-world impact on energy savings may be minimal.

Magnetic Cables: While magnetic cables offer convenience, there are some potential drawbacks. They may not be as secure as traditional cables, and the magnetic connection could introduce additional points of failure. Additionally, some concerns exist around the potential for interference with data transfer speeds. Noise claims their cable offers 480Mbps transfer speeds, which is sufficient for most users, but high-performance data transfers might be impacted.

Compatibility: It’s important to verify the compatibility of the Noise Power Series with your devices. While Noise claims compatibility with over 10,000 devices, it’s always best to double-check for specific models.

Pricing: The Noise Power Series offers a range of adapters with varying wattages and pricing options. Consider your power needs and budget when selecting the best adapter for you. The magnetic cable is a separate purchase, so factor that into your overall cost consideration.
